#c1363e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c1363e is composed of 75.7% red, 21.2%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72% magenta, 67.9%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 356.5 degrees, a saturation of 56.3% and a lightness of 48.4%. #c1363e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6c7c with #830000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#c1363e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090303 is the darkest color, while #fdf9f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c1363e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f7979 is the less saturated color, while #f10714 is the most saturated one.
